Anyone else seen The Hobbit yet?

If you did, did you notice Ian McKellen's sleight of hand? It was such a non-moment in the film that I kind of only half noticed it and I'd like to see it again with total awareness of what I'm about to see, but fireballs and CGI aside, Gandalf does at least one actual bit of magic.

In the scene after the dwarves wreck Bilbo's hole, there's a gathering where he produced a key, using a beautiful slow twirl flipstick production. I've been trying it with a few pens around the house (I've only ever done a flipstick as a sudden snap before, so I had to have a go) and it really does look elegant.

I'm now wondering if he does any other sleight of hand in the film. Might go see it again. In 3D this time, and without the 5 nerds on the row behind talking...
